At Natera, employees contribute to a global leader in cell-free DNA testing, an essential field for advancements in oncology, women's health, and organ health. The company's strong commitment to validation through over 100 peer-reviewed publications highlights a dedication to data-driven results and continuous improvement, making it a place of rigorous scientific endeavor and innovation. Here, one can actively participate in shaping the future of personalized healthcare decisions, fostering a dynamic and impactful work environment.
